Redeemed Dreams is the podcast for former pro ball players who had their dream ripped away and are left wondering, “Now what?” Hosted with raw honesty and real understanding, it’s a place where fallen ballplayers come to hear the stories, strategies, and straight talk they need to rise again. Each episode dives into what life looks like after the game ends — the loss of identity, the weight of responsibility, the grind of survival — and how to build a future that feels like a win, not a consolation prize. Through candid interviews with athletes who’ve walked this road and won a new game, plus expert insight on business, mindset, and purpose, you’ll see it’s possible to get back up, take another swing, and succeed at something new. Redeemed Dreams is for every ballplayer who’s ready to stop looking back and start building forward. This is how fallen ballplayers rise again.
